    Microsoft has changed the way they deploy updates (thanks guys, I like challenge).

    If you have apply updates as offline package in mdt, this can be the solution for your problem (and, this can help other people by the way because there is no solution at the moment):

    So now, when you want to deploy latest W10 version with latest updates, you need to use 7zip to decompress it twice and add the good update. They created something called "group package" inside you have SSU and the security update but if you add the "group package" with MDT you will have errors, just decompress this 1 time and you will find out 2 .msu, add them in your MDT

    FYI: package of 2021-03 are the first concerned, still no documentation about it :)
